Transaction f63f8b2a04abdddca71d2a8902c4a6f295caf98e04aadece15ee99ffd41cf338
1 Input
1 Output
-
f63f8b2a04abdddca71d2a8902c4a6f295caf98e04aadece15ee99ffd41cf338:0
- value
- 6453783
- script pubkey
- OP_0 OP_PUSHBYTES_20 e28d3e4c76b9383160c6e135385a4c658bf802ae
- address
- bc1qu2xnunrkhyurzcxxuy6nskjvvk9lsq4wwugp92